PHOTO RELEASE: Oregon Air Guard unit returns from duty in Iraq
 
Members of the Oregon Air National Guard returned to Oregon on Friday, Aug. 7, after a six-month deployment to Iraq.

Twenty-nine airmen from the 142nd Security Forces Squadron arrived on four separate commercial flights at the Portland International Airport, to throngs of well-wishers, family members and friends.

The airmen were tasked with base and checkpoint security, as well as checking credentials for all personnel entering Kirkuk Air Base in Iraq. They conducted almost 20,000 miles of mounted patrols in and around the base, and endured 15 rocket attacks and more than 100 incidents of small-arms fire.
